Sass是一款成熟、穩(wěn)定、強(qiáng)大的專業(yè)級(jí)CSS擴(kuò)展語(yǔ)言,它是一款強(qiáng)化CSS的輔助工具,在CSS語(yǔ)法的基礎(chǔ)上增加了變量(variables)、嵌套(nestedrules)、混合(mixins)、導(dǎo)入(inline imports)等高級(jí)功能,讓CSS更加強(qiáng)大與優(yōu)雅。使用Sass以及Sass的樣式庫(kù)(如Compass)有助于更好地組織管理樣式文件,以及更高效地開(kāi)發(fā)項(xiàng)目。查看全文>>
在開(kāi)發(fā)中,為了確保不同瀏覽器的默認(rèn)樣式統(tǒng)一,通常會(huì)對(duì)樣式進(jìn)行初始化,也就是在頁(yè)面中定義一些初始樣式,用來(lái)覆蓋瀏覽器的默認(rèn)樣式。在移動(dòng)端Web開(kāi)發(fā)中,初始化默認(rèn)樣式推薦使用Normalize.css樣式庫(kù),因?yàn)樗哂腥缦绿攸c(diǎn)。查看全文>>
當(dāng)一個(gè)數(shù)據(jù)需要多次使用時(shí),可以利用變量將數(shù)據(jù)保存起來(lái)。變量就是指程序中一個(gè)已經(jīng)命名的存儲(chǔ)單元,它的主要作用就是為數(shù)據(jù)操作提供存放信息的容器。下面將對(duì)變量的命名、變量的聲明與賦值進(jìn)行講解查看全文>>
Dreamweaver是十分簡(jiǎn)單方便的網(wǎng)頁(yè)制作工具,軟件安裝后,雙擊運(yùn)行桌面上的軟件圖標(biāo),進(jìn)入軟件界面。這里建議用戶依次選擇菜單欄中的“窗口”→“工作區(qū)布局”→“經(jīng)典”選項(xiàng),如圖1所示。查看全文>>
在JavaScript中,對(duì)象是一種數(shù)據(jù)類型,它是由屬性和方法組成的一個(gè)集合。屬性是指事物的特征,方法是指事物的行為。在代碼中,屬性可以看成是對(duì)象中保存的一個(gè)變量,使用“對(duì)象.屬性名”,方法可以看成是對(duì)象中保存的一個(gè)函數(shù),使用“對(duì)象.方法名()”進(jìn)行訪問(wèn)。假設(shè)現(xiàn)在有一個(gè)手機(jī)對(duì)象p1,則可以用以下代碼來(lái)訪問(wèn)p1的屬性或調(diào)用p1的方法。查看全文>>
W3C定義了一系列的DOM接口,利用DOM可完成對(duì)HTML文檔內(nèi)所有元素的獲取、訪問(wèn)、標(biāo)簽屬性和樣式的設(shè)置等操作。在實(shí)際開(kāi)發(fā)中,諸如改變盒子的大小、標(biāo)簽欄的切換、購(gòu)物車功能等帶有交互效果的頁(yè)面,都離不開(kāi)DOM。DOM中將HTML文檔視為樹(shù)結(jié)構(gòu),被稱之為文檔樹(shù)模型,把文檔映射成樹(shù)形結(jié)構(gòu),通過(guò)節(jié)點(diǎn)對(duì)象對(duì)其處理,處理的結(jié)果可以加入到當(dāng)前的頁(yè)面。樹(shù)形結(jié)構(gòu)如圖1所示。查看全文>>